High school senior dies in Shelby wreck

SHELBY, N.C. — A high school senior died after she lost control of her car and crashed into a tree in Shelby, officials said.

Elizabeth Drum died Tuesday afternoon in the wreck on South Lafayette Street, Channel 9’s news partners at the Shelby Star reported.

Troopers said Drum’s car ran off the side of the road and she overcorrected.

Eck Hollyfield heard the crash from his home and said there have been several wrecks here during heavy rainstorms.

"Water spans across the road up there,” Hollyfield said. “Over the years there, it has happened several times, four or five times in my yard."

The Department of Transportation said they were unaware of problems there but said they will launch an investigation into whether water does pond on the roadway.

Drum's classmates at Crest High School will wear red and orange in her honor Wednesday.

"She's going to be a part of it, still with the ceremony and with us," student Nikki McDaniel said.

"She is still part of the class of 2016,” friend LeeAnn Hubbard said. “She is still our friend and I hope she is smiling down at us like she smiled every day."
